总结:通俗地说,服务端渲染是由服务器创建的。 页面内容可以动态改变,也称为动态页面。 总的来说,服务器端渲染是指在服务器端完成页面的结构绑定,发送到浏览器,并为其绑定状态和事件,使其成为完全交互的页面的页面处理技术。
服务器端渲染(Server-Side Rendering)就是简单的 HTML。 它们也称为动态页面,因为当连接到服务器时页面内容会动态变化。 早期的php、asp、jsp等服务器页面都是在服务器端渲染的。 不过基于React技术栈还是存在一些差异的。 构建服务器捆绑包时,弹出模块的数量由服务器端确定。 客户端包与以前相同,只是这次它是水合物而不是渲染。
总的来说,服务器端渲染是一种页面处理技术,它在服务器端完成页面的HTML结构的组合,发送到浏览器,并将状态和事件绑定到浏览器。 这将是一个完全交互式的页面。 过程。
服务器渲染可以用来解决搜索引擎优化(SEO)要求较高的网站或异步检索内容的页面等问题。
对SEO有效,初屏绘制速度快。 对SEO有帮助的是Vue SSR使用Node.js构建页面渲染服务,在服务器端完成页面渲染(以前必须在客户端完成的页面渲染现在在服务器端完成)的意思。 这使得输出更容易。 您可以增加 SEO 友好页面的数量。 在前后端分离的项目中,首屏渲染速度最快,前端部分首先加载静态资源,然后使用异步方法检索数据,最后我需要做的是渲染页面。 在静态资源检索和异步数据检索阶段,页面上没有任何数据,这会影响初始屏幕渲染速度和用户体验。
评论前必须登录!
注册